[03]Computed insights

Arithmetic · working shown
  1. 3 names stood 2 times each, the most on this seat.

    names matched ignoring spacing and punctuation · Manvendra Singh · Rizwan Ali · Rajendra Prasad
  2. In 2022 the top two candidates took 86.2% of the votes.

    45.3 + 40.9 = 86.2
  3. 59 of 71 candidatures polled under one-sixth of the votes (83.1%).

    count(vote % < 16.67) = 59 · 59 ÷ 71 = 83.1%
  4. The field went from 16 in 2002 to 14 in 2022.

    14 − 16 = −2
  5. Independents filed 23 of 71 candidatures and won 0.

    count(party = IND) = 23 · won = 0
  6. SP won 3 of the 5 contests it stood in (60.0%).

    3 ÷ 5 = 60.0%

Each line is arithmetic over the candidate rows on this page.
